Overview of the Fellowship Programme
The Delhi government has unveiled an innovative Tourism and Heritage Fellowship Programme designed specifically to help preserve and promote the cultural essence of the city. This initiative targets young professionals, whose involvement could greatly enhance tourism efforts in the national capital.
Key Features of the Programme
The programme aims to select 40 young professionals annually, each receiving a monthly stipend of INR 50,000. This unique initiative helps provide aspiring talents with the tools needed to become effective contributors in tourism and heritage sectors. Participants can expect a dynamic experience, engaging in various activities that harness Delhi’s rich cultural heritage.
Training and Opportunities
Selected individuals will engage in hands-on activities including:
- Leading heritage walks to explore historical sites
- Creating engaging content for digital platforms
- Managing guided tours that enhance visitor experiences
- Coordinating exciting tourism campaigns and events
- Supporting operations at prominent venues such as Dilli Haat
- Assisting in film shooting arrangements and MICE activities
Eligibility Criteria
Applicant requirements are aimed at nurturing a skilled workforce in tourism. Key criteria include:
- Age: Must be under 35 years old
- Education: At least a graduate degree, with preference given to those with tourism qualifications
- Experience: Minimum of one year in the tourism or a related field
- Skills: Proficiency in Hindi and English, along with good digital skills
Government Perspective
Chief Minister Rekha Gupta underlined that this fellowship aligns with the vision of creating a self-sufficient India by utilizing local talent. By fostering a sense of ownership among the youth, the initiative promotes traditional knowledge systems while reducing reliance on external consultants. The government envisions this programme as a gateway to transforming Delhi into a more vibrant and internationally recognized tourism destination.

Participant Benefits
At the conclusion of the year-long fellowship, participants will receive a completion certificate, aided by practical experience and a strong network in the tourism field. Such qualifications will undoubtedly enhance their employability and insights into the hospitality industry.
